Israel Afeare, a.



k.a. Israel DMW, Davido's logistics manager, has spoken out after being harassed by a herbal supplier over a broken contract.

Recall that Israel DMW was called out by an herbalist going by the username Mideshaven for blocking her after taking N800,000 from her.

Mideshaven, in a trending video on social media, said, “@isrealdmw wants to rip me off $800,000. I am calling online because all efforts to reach him have failed. I’ve been begging him since December. I sent emails to the DMW lawyer and managers to speak to him but got no response.

Israel responded to this by writing on his Instagram page that @Mideshaven had not paid him the full amount he had requested but had nonetheless insisted that he promote her goods.

He explained that the initial agreement was to post her products on his story, which he did twice.

Mide, pay the amount I have asked for if you truly want a video of me promoting your products because it was never in our agreement. Our initial agreement was for me to post your product on my Instagram story, which I did twice. Thanks. "Agreement is agreement.”
